VariousWords beta
Related Terms:
Noun
Definition: Stypandra glauca, a rhizomatous perennial plant of southern Australia, with blue lily-like flowers.
VariousWords beta
Definition: Stypandra glauca, a rhizomatous perennial plant of southern Australia, with blue lily-like flowers.